summarylog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--.SRCINFO9
-rw-r--r--.gitignore4
-rw-r--r--PKGBUILD10
3 files changed, 12 insertions, 11 deletions
diff --git a/.SRCINFO b/.SRCINFO
index 1683d599c3c0..4dd8cd970e9c 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,6 +1,4 @@
-# Generated by mksrcinfo v8
-# Tue Aug 14 21:46:47 UTC 2018
-pkgbase = xscreensaver-arch-logo
+pkgbase = xscreensaver-arch-logo-nogdm
pkgdesc = Screen saver and locker for the X Window System with Arch Linux branding
pkgver = 5.40
pkgrel = 1
@@ -10,13 +8,12 @@ pkgbase = xscreensaver-arch-logo
makedepends = bc
makedepends = intltool
makedepends = libxpm
- makedepends = gdm
depends = libglade
depends = libxmu
depends = glu
depends = xorg-appres
depends = perl-libwww
- optdepends = gdm: for login manager support
+ depends = pam
provides = xscreensaver
conflicts = xscreensaver
backup = etc/pam.d/xscreensaver
@@ -33,5 +30,5 @@ pkgbase = xscreensaver-arch-logo
sha1sums = 203ca4f21e0d42263fc0ebb796eaf968c457d93a
sha1sums = 619cff60b77812545493dbedb0ba247a37f381e5
-pkgname = xscreensaver-arch-logo
+pkgname = xscreensaver-arch-logo-nogdm
diff --git a/.gitignore b/.gitignore
new file mode 100644
index 000000000000..f71c635dafda
--- /dev/null
+++ b/.gitignore
@@ -0,0 +1,4 @@
+*
+!.gitignore
+!PKGBUILD
+!.SRCINFO
diff --git a/PKGBUILD b/PKGBUILD
index 09bfd37b57a8..ebac3919df7a 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-1,17 +1,17 @@
# Maintainer: graysky <graysky AT archlinux DOT us>
# Contributor: Thomas Mudrunka <harvie@@email..cz>
# Contributer: Eric Belanger <eric@archlinux.org>
+# Contributor: Jakub Kądziołka <kuba@kadziolka.net>
-pkgname=xscreensaver-arch-logo
+pkgname=xscreensaver-arch-logo-nogdm
pkgver=5.40
pkgrel=1
pkgdesc="Screen saver and locker for the X Window System with Arch Linux branding"
arch=('x86_64')
url="http://www.jwz.org/xscreensaver/"
license=('BSD')
-depends=('libglade' 'libxmu' 'glu' 'xorg-appres' 'perl-libwww')
-makedepends=('bc' 'intltool' 'libxpm' 'gdm')
-optdepends=('gdm: for login manager support')
+depends=('libglade' 'libxmu' 'glu' 'xorg-appres' 'perl-libwww' 'pam')
+makedepends=('bc' 'intltool' 'libxpm')
conflicts=('xscreensaver')
provides=('xscreensaver')
backup=('etc/pam.d/xscreensaver')
@@ -29,7 +29,7 @@ build() {
install -Dm644 "$srcdir"/logo-180.xpm "${srcdir}"/${pkgname%%-*}-${pkgver}/utils/images/logo-180.xpm
./configure --prefix=/usr --sysconfdir=/etc --localstatedir=/var \
--libexecdir=/usr/lib --with-x-app-defaults=/usr/share/X11/app-defaults \
- --with-pam --with-login-manager --with-gtk --with-gl \
+ --with-pam --without-login-manager --with-gtk --with-gl \
--without-gle --with-pixbuf --with-jpeg
make
}